Shared Lab 4 is operated jointly with the Kestrel Instruments team next door. Visitors require pre-approval from either lab lead; same-day requests are refused. The facilities desk issues day passes for the outer corridor only — lab entry is always escorted. Maximum two visitors per host. Coats and bags stay in the corridor lockers. Escorts must badge in first and out last. The inner door keypad uses the current rotation code, shown below.

turnstile pass: bdg-FVNQRS-72965873

Q: I'm a contractor — can I use the shared lab on Level 3?

A: Yes, with conditions. The lab is shared between the Merrowby Instruments team and the neighbouring Halden group, so bench space is first-come. Contractors must sign in at the lab logbook, wear safety glasses past the yellow line, and must not move either team's equipment between benches. Access is by keypad only; your escort is not required after your induction. The current code is below.

staff pass of haweg-bafop = bdg-G-69

v2.9.4 — Fixed flaky DNS resolution in the Norwick gateway. Resolver now retries with jittered backoff and caches negative results for 30s instead of 300s. Removed the blocking lookup in the health-check path. Tests added for timeout and truncated-response cases. Review questions go to the author listed below.

account owner for bawip-tahag: Raleth Quenok

Subject: Partner SFTP drop — new owner

Hi,

As you review the pending changes to the Harborline ingest scripts, note that ownership of the partner SFTP drop is changing at the end of the month. This includes key rotation, the nightly pull job, and the quarantine folder for malformed files. Review comments on the retry logic should still go through the normal PR flow, but questions about drop-folder conventions or partner onboarding now go to the new owner. The incoming owner is listed below.

signatory, tagaf-bahaf: Praael Fenmir Rusok